Nelissa Hicks

Partner

Nelissa is Partner at Rothera Bray with a demonstrated history of working in the legal services industry. Nelissa has over 20 years’ experience as a Wills, Probate, Tax and Trusts solicitor and is based at our Loughborough office. She is skilled in Inheritance Tax Planning and the Administration of Trusts and Estates.

Nelissa is an experienced private client solicitor and Partner at Rothera Bray. She is able to assist with the preparation of wills (with or without trusts) and lasting powers of attorney. She is also skilled in inheritance tax planning, often working alongside financial planners and accountants to come up with joint, creative solutions for mutual clients.

Nelissa has significant experience in the administration of trusts and estates and provides solutions in an efficient but empathetic manner.

Warm, approachable and efficient, Nelissa is also a full Accredited Member of the Association of Lifetime Lawyers, and a STEP Trust and Estate Practitioner.

Career Highlights

  • Nelissa joined Flint Bishop in 2006 and was one of 5 promoted to Associate in 2011 when the firm introduced Associateships
  • In 2014 she went on to join Chesterton House Legal Services, a start-up law firm offering a joined-up approach with financial planning and accountancy services
  • Joined Knights in 2016 as a Senior Associate
  • In 2020 Nelissa joined Rothera Bray as a Senior Associate
  • Nelissa became a Partner at Rothera Bray in October 2022

Qualifications

  • Nelissa obtained her law degree at Nottingham University in 1999
  • Completed the legal practice course (LPC) at Nottingham Trent University in 2001
  • Gained Society of Trust and Estate Practitioners (STEP) accreditation through the exam route 2011-2013
  • Obtained a distinction with the Advanced Certificate in the UK Tax for International Clients with STEP in 2015
